(Downie) July 9, 1912 - January 24, 2002. After a lengthy illness, Emily McLaughlin passed away at the Pinecrest Home for the Aged, Kenora, Ontario. She is survived by her husband, John McLaughlin, her daughters Phyllis Downie of Winnipeg, Manitoba and Jean (Albert) Rolfe of Montreal, Quebec and her sons, John Jr. and Keith McLaughlin of Kenora, as well as, numerous grandchildren and great-grandchildren. Emily was predeceased by her first husband, James Downie. Emily was born in Wawanesa, Manitoba and moved to Winnipeg with the family at an early age. She attended numerous schools in Winnipeg along with Business College. She worked for the Department of Transportation and retired in 1977 after a long career. During her working career and long after, Emily travelled the world extensively making many friends. She visited every continent and most of her travels were accomplished on foot. Of her many trips, Emily particularly enjoyed travel in China. After Emily's retirement, she moved to Kenora and resided at Benidickson Court with her husband, John.
